She wrote this book after 'adopting' (ie. taking in to her home for rehab) two orphaned baby beavers that no one else could care for. Wildlife services didn't have the facilities to care for them, and they would have died on their own. The book chronicles how Anderson took care of them, related to them, and the behavior she watched them exhibit. Later on, she took in other wildlife (a deer, an eagle, a woodchuck) and the stories she tells are so unbelievable you probably won't believe me when I say that things like this happened:
-- from an early age, the beavers would ask to be picked up, by stretching their arms up at Anderson, gesturing "up! up!" like a human toddler
-- one of the beavers was kidnapped by the woodchuck and held captive... no, I am not kidding, and I really really want to say more but I don't want to spoil this fascinating story
-- the beavers would clean their food dishes until they sparkled, and then stack them against the side of their enclosure... yes, stack them, like cleanliness-obsessed little Martha Stewarts
